Newton Schools Foundation Inc

Organization Overview

Newton Schools Foundation Inc is located in Newton, MA. The organization was established in 1970. According to its NTEE Classification (B20) the organization is classified as: Elementary & Secondary Schools, under the broad grouping of Education and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Newton Schools Foundation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 06/2021, Newton Schools Foundation Inc generated $343.5k in total revenue. This represents a relatively dramatic decline in revenue. Over the past 6 years, the organization has seen revenues fall by an average of (3.6%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$297.3k during the year ending 06/2021. As we would expect to see with falling revenues, expenses have declined by (3.9%) per year over the past 6 years.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

TO ADVANCE EXCELLENCE AND EQUITY IN THE NEWTON PUBLIC SCHOOLS BY FUNDING AND SUPPORTING PROMISING INITIATIVES, PROFESSIONAL DEVELOPMENT, AND PROGRAMS THAT CLOSE GAPS IN ACHIEVEMENT AND OPPORTUNITY.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

NEWTON SCHOOLS FOUNDATION WORKS WITH THE PUBLIC SCHOOL SYSTEM OF NEWTON, MA TO PROVIDE FINANCIAL AND OTHER SUPPORT OF THREE GOALS: INCUBATION OF PROMISING AND EMERGING APPROACHES TO TEACHING AND LEARNING WITH VIBRANT AND DYNAMIC CURRICULUM, COLLABORATIVE TEACHERS WHO CAN EVOLVE THEIR PRACTICES, AND ACTIVELY ENGAGE STUDENTS; INVESTMENT IN OPPORTUNITIES TO EXTEND AND DEEPEN THE TEACHING PRACTICES OF EDUCATORS THROUGH PROFESSIONAL DEVELOPMENT THAT SUPPLEMENTS THE EXISTING OPPORTUNITIES IN THE SYSTEM; AND, SUPPORT OF PROGRAMS THAT REDUCE GAPS IN ACHIEVEMENT AND OPPORTUNITY AND PROMOTE EQUITY IN NEWTON'S DIVERSE STUDENT POPULATION. IN ALL CASES, NSF WORKS WITH SCHOOL SYSTEM ADMINISTRATORS TO UNDERSTAND THE RELEVANT NEEDS OR REQUESTS AND TO DECIDE THE ACTIVITIES TO BE SUPPORTED.
